Got a call this morning from our old friend Big10PonyFan, who said he had read the following in the Minneapolis Star-Tribune:
"Defensive tackle to transfer
Gophers defensive tackle Serge Elizee has left the football program and will transfer to another school after spending only one semester at Minnesota.... Elizee said he thought he was going to be admitted to the Carlson School of Management when he arrived at Minnesota in January after spending two seasons at the College of the Sequoias in California. However, he did not get accepted, and he said he likely will transfer to SMU. The new coaching staff has granted him his release...."
